Hack The Box is the Cyber Performance Center with the mission to provide a human-first platform to create and maintain high-performing cybersecurity individuals and organizations. Hack The Box is the only platform that unites upskilling, workforce development, and the human focus in the cybersecurity industry, and it’s trusted by organizations worldwide for driving their teams to peak performance. Offering an all-in-one environment for continuous growth, assessment, and recruitment, Hack The Box provides solutions for all cybersecurity domains. Launched in 2017, Hack The Box brings together the largest global cybersecurity community of more than 2.6 million platform members. Rapidly growing its international footprint and reach, Hack The Box is headquartered in the UK, with additional offices in the US, Australia, and Greece.
SecureFlag provides comprehensive developer training focused on secure coding practices, enhancing software security from the ground up.
SecureFlag is designed to integrate seamlessly into development workflows, enabling teams to improve code security without disrupting productivity. By focusing on real-world scenarios, developers can quickly learn to recognize and mitigate security vulnerabilities. This hands-on approach ensures developers build skills that have immediate application in producing secure software.
